Teachers hailed for improving Primary School Education in Mangochi

Mangochi District Education, Youth and Sports Officer, Joe Magombo, has heaped praise on primary school Head-teachers following outstanding performance by learners during Primary School Leaving Certificate Examinations.

Magombo was speaking during the Annual General Meeting for the Association of Headteachers held at Lisumbwi Secondary School in Monkey Bay.

He attributed the 7% increase in pass rate, from 84% last year to 91% this year,
to their dedication, hard work and commitment.

The AGM is expected to come up with ways that can improve education standards, collaboration with parents as well as address some cultural practices that hinder children’s education.
